🏢 What kind of SPAC is JATT II Acquisition Corp.?

JATT II Acquisition Corp. was established to discover and merge unlisted companies in the biotech and life sciences sectors, as is special purpose acquisition company. The sponsor deposits the public offering funds into a trust account, and operates with the goal of finding an acquisition target and completing the merger within a set period of time.

Our core business is not our own products or sales, but rather acquiring unlisted biotech companies with growth potential and listing them indirectly. Recently, mergers with immune/antibody-based new drug development companies have been pursued and the focus has been on life science themes.

special purpose acquisition company, unlike general business companies, does not have its own sales or operating profits. JATT II Acquisition Corp.'s financial structure is to deposit funds raised through public offering into a trust account and preserve them until the merger is completed. The source of profit depends on the performance that the merger target company will generate after listing, and the main financial flow until the merger is interest generated from trust funds. Therefore, securing a target with growth potential rather than diversifying sales is the key variable that determines corporate value.

⚔️ JATT II Acquisition Corp. Advantages and risks of merger

Although there is a structural opportunity to list a biotech company with growth potential, there is great uncertainty as its value depends on whether the merger will be successful and the performance of the target company.

💪 Core Competitiveness

Trust Fund Safeguards
If the merger fails, the downside risk is limited by the structure of returning the deposited trust funds to shareholders.
Clear industry focus
We aim to identify targets with expertise by narrowing down our acquisition targets to biotech and life sciences.
bypass listing channel
It provides a listing route for promising unlisted companies and connects them with growth capital.

⚠️ Key risks

risk of merger failure
Failure to find and merge with a suitable target within a set period of time may result in liquidation.
lack of performance
Since it does not have its own sales or operating entity, it is difficult to assess corporate value before the merger.
Volatility after merger
After the merger is completed, stock price volatility may increase significantly depending on the target company's performance.
Possibility of share dilution
In the process of raising additional funds and issuing shares, the shares of existing shareholders may be diluted.

The key risk is the possibility that the merger itself will not go through. If the target company is not secured within the deadline, liquidation procedures will be initiated, and even if the merger is successful, the stock price may be significantly shaken if the target company fails in clinical trials or commercialization or has poor performance.
